Taikoma
SQL Server 2014 Developer - duplicate (do not use) SQL Server 2014 Enterprise - duplicate (do not use) SQL Server 2014 Enterprise Core - duplicate (do not use) SQL Server 2014 Express - duplicate (do not use) SQL Server 2014 Standard - duplicate (do not use) SQL Server 2016 Developer - duplicate (do not use) SQL Server 2016 Enterprise - duplicate (do not use) SQL Server 2016 Enterprise Core - duplicate (do not use) SQL Server 2016 Standard - duplicate (do not use) SQL Server 2016 Service Pack 1

Simptomai

Tarkime, kad kuriate sinonimas saugomą procedūrą, kurioje atsižvelgiama į lentelės reikšmių parametrą "Microsoft SQL Server" 2014 arba "2016". Kai vykdote tą saugomą procedūrą naudodami sinonimą nuotolinių procedūrų skambučiui (RPC), pvz., iš C# programos, vykdymas nepavyksta ir gaunate tokį klaidos pranešimą:

Klaida: 2809 Užklausos <procedūros pavadinimas> nepavyko, nes <objekto pavadinimas> yra sinonimas objektas.

Pastaba Kai vykdote tą pačią saugomą procedūrą naudodami "SQL Server Management Studio", ši problema nekyla.

Sprendimas

Problema išspręsta šiuose kaupiamajame "SQL Server" naujinimuose:

Kiekvienas naujas Kaupiamasis naujinimas, skirtas "SQL Server", yra visos karštosios pataisos ir visos saugos pataisos, kurios buvo pridėtos prie ankstesnio kaupiamojo naujinimo. Rekomenduojame atsisiųsti ir įdiegti naujausius kaupiamuosius SQL serverio naujinimus:

Statusą

"Microsoft" patvirtino, kad tai yra "Microsoft" produktų, išvardytų skyriuje "taikoma", problema.

Nuorodos

Sužinokite apie terminologiją , kurią "Microsoft" naudoja programinės įrangos naujinimams apibūdinti.

Reikia daugiau pagalbos?

Norite daugiau parinkčių?

Sužinokite apie prenumeratos pranašumus, peržiūrėkite mokymo kursus, sužinokite, kaip apsaugoti savo įrenginį ir kt.